黑狐家游戏

分布式存储系统入门,探究最少节点数量及其优化策略,分布式存储最少几个节点组成

欧气 0 0

本文目录导读:

  1. 分布式存储最少节点数量
  2. 分布式存储优化策略

随着大数据时代的到来,分布式存储系统因其高可用性、高扩展性和高性能等特点,逐渐成为数据存储的主流选择,如何构建一个高效、可靠的分布式存储系统,成为许多开发者关注的焦点,本文将从分布式存储的最少节点数量出发,探讨其优化策略,为读者提供有益的参考。

分布式存储最少节点数量

分布式存储系统的最小节点数量取决于多个因素,如存储需求、网络带宽、存储设备性能等,以下几种情况下,分布式存储系统的最少节点数量如下:

分布式存储系统入门,探究最少节点数量及其优化策略,分布式存储最少几个节点组成

图片来源于网络,如有侵权联系删除

1、存储需求较小:当存储需求较小时,可使用2个节点构建分布式存储系统,这种情况下,系统可提供高可用性,同时保持较低的硬件成本。

2、存储需求适中:对于存储需求适中的场景,建议使用3个节点构建分布式存储系统,系统既具备较高的可用性,又可降低单点故障风险。

3、存储需求较大:当存储需求较大时,建议使用5个节点构建分布式存储系统,这种配置可满足高可用性、高扩展性和高性能的要求,同时降低硬件成本。

需要注意的是,上述推荐的最少节点数量仅供参考,实际应用中,还需根据具体需求进行评估和调整。

分布式存储优化策略

1、数据副本策略

分布式存储系统通常采用数据副本策略,以提高数据的可靠性和可用性,以下是几种常见的数据副本策略:

(1)N+1副本:将数据存储在N个节点上,再额外存储1个副本,当N个节点中任意一个发生故障时,系统仍能保证数据的完整性和可用性。

(2)N+2副本:将数据存储在N个节点上,再额外存储2个副本,这种策略可进一步提高数据的可靠性和可用性,但会增加存储成本。

(3)Raid策略:采用Raid技术对数据进行存储,提高数据读写性能和可靠性,Raid策略有多种类型,如Raid 0、Raid 1、Raid 5等。

分布式存储系统入门,探究最少节点数量及其优化策略,分布式存储最少几个节点组成

图片来源于网络,如有侵权联系删除

2、负载均衡策略

分布式存储系统中的负载均衡策略,可提高系统的整体性能,以下是一些常见的负载均衡策略:

(1)轮询策略:按照顺序将请求分配给各个节点,实现负载均衡。

(2)权重轮询策略:根据节点性能、负载等因素,为各个节点分配不同的权重,实现更合理的负载均衡。

(3)最少连接策略:将请求分配给连接数最少的节点,降低系统延迟。

3、故障检测与恢复策略

分布式存储系统中的故障检测与恢复策略,可确保系统在发生故障时,能够快速恢复,以下是一些常见的故障检测与恢复策略:

(1)心跳机制:节点间通过心跳信号进行通信,检测其他节点的状态。

(2)副本选举:当主节点发生故障时,从副本节点中选举新的主节点,保证数据的可用性。

分布式存储系统入门,探究最少节点数量及其优化策略,分布式存储最少几个节点组成

图片来源于网络,如有侵权联系删除

(3)自动恢复:当检测到节点故障时,系统自动进行数据恢复,确保数据的一致性。

4、数据去重策略

分布式存储系统中的数据去重策略,可降低存储空间消耗,以下是一些常见的数据去重策略:

(1)哈希去重:对数据进行哈希计算,将相同哈希值的数据视为重复数据,进行去重。

(2)差异比较去重:对数据进行差异比较,找出重复数据,进行去重。

(3)索引去重:根据索引信息,找出重复数据,进行去重。

分布式存储系统的最少节点数量取决于具体需求,通常情况下,2-5个节点可满足大部分场景,在实际应用中,需根据需求选择合适的节点数量,并采取相应的优化策略,以提高系统的性能、可靠性和可用性,希望本文对您有所帮助。

标签: #分布式存储最少几个节点

黑狐家游戏
  • 评论列表

留言评论